Output fddc4e76730c26c064ac95fd74d21ae17503c611a989e34d0e594bfe1da04b5f:0

value
573641
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e63d3d8bddd1acfb92d468e1aa7f8451f32d75d7 OP_EQUALVERIFY OP_CHECKSIG
address
1MzPnBRNNaF8WQgZ5dZwnzFiiSFFMGedLQ
transaction
fddc4e76730c26c064ac95fd74d21ae17503c611a989e34d0e594bfe1da04b5f
spent
true